Position Summary:

The Center for Online and Continuing Education at Florida Atlantic University is seeking a student worker to assist with Online Enrollment and Student Success initiatives. The successful candidate will work remotely.

Duties include:
• Develop and execute marketing and communications strategies for the Online Student Advisory Board (“OSAB”) to engage the participation of other online students.
• Create engaging content for digital platforms to promote OSAB initiatives, events, and services.
• Manage OSAB’s social media presence, including content scheduling and community engagement.
• Collaborate with FAU’s marketing team to reach the online student community effectively.
• Commitment to serving in the role for at least one academic year.
• Perform other job-related duties as assigned.

Minimum Qualifications:
Degree-seeking undergraduate student with a minimum of six credit hours (or twelve if international) and a 2.0 GPA. Degree-seeking graduate student with a minimum of five credit hours (or nine if international) and a 3.0 GPA. Must be enrolled in at least one FAU online course for the fall and spring semesters.

Preferred skills include, but not limited to:

Strong written, verbal, interpersonal, organizational, and time management skills.

Ability to work independently with limited supervision.

Comfortable applying or willing to learn a great range of software and technology.

Perform other duties and responsibilities as assigned.

Receptive to feedback and willingness to improve skills.

More specifically:

Experience in marketing, communications, or social media management.

Strong writing and content creation skills.

Familiarity with social media platforms and analytics.

Creative thinking skills with attention to detail and ability to engage online audiences.
